Prince, the legendary performer who died tragically in April, spent most of his life within his estate in Paisley Park Studios in Minnesota ...

To avoid the cold winters of Minnesota, the Prince enjoyed in luxury on the island of Providenciales. In 2010, he bought the island's villa of 1.000 m2 for 12 million dollars, which is located in an idyllic location of the island, and has 10 bedrooms, 10 bathrooms, a lighted tennis court, dock for small boats, a private beach with white sand and natural , purple driveway.

The main villa on the possession has room for the guests with a view of the ocean on two sides overlooking the marina in its second part. There are also a lounge, dining room, spacious kitchen with top appliances, covered terrace with a large space to enjoy cocktails, master suite with fitted wardrobes, gym, studio, media room and home theater.
